Required Documents for Chola MS Bike Insurance Claim
To settle a bike insurance claim, you need the following documents:
- Completed and signed claim form
- Copy of the vehicle's Registration Certificate (RC)
- Driving licence of the person who was driving during the accident
- Copy of the insurance policy
- For non-cashless claims: original repair estimate, repair invoice, and payment receipt
- For cashless claims: original repair invoice
Chola MS Bike Insurance Claim Process
Follow these steps to claim your Cholamandalam 2-wheeler insurance:
1Step 1
To start the process, call the toll-free number at 1800-208-5544 or visit the insurer's website.
2Step 2
After receiving the information, the insurance company will send a surveyor who will inspect the damage at the spot of the accident site or at any garage and start the claim process.
3Step 3
You can also use LVS-live video streaming to make the process easy. Through this, the real-time assessment of your bike's damages is possible.
4Step 4
Then, you have to submit the documents required for verification.
5Step 5
The insurer, in case of cashless claims, will make the payments directly to the network garage, and your two-wheeler will be repaired.
Common Reasons for Cholamandalam Bike Insurance Claim Rejection
Here are some conditions where Chola MS can reject claims:
- Driving under intoxication
- Acts of negligence
- Driving without a licence or an invalid licence
- Wrong claims on coverage amount
- Accident due to poor vehicle maintenance
- Manipulation of facts
- Filing fake claims
- Insufficient details are given for the claim
- Delay in informing the insurer in case of an accident.
